Mass tuned ladder rung and ladder formed therewith
A rung which can be installed in a ladder is disclosed which comprises a first plate having first and second ends, each of the first and second ends having a relief tab and an opening, and a second plate, the second plate being identical to the first plate, the first and second plates being nestable such that the relief tabs of the first plate insert through the openings of the second plate to form the rungs.

LADDER
A ladder having a frame with three leg members wherein the leg members are adjustable in length so as to provide a level orientation of the ladder subsequent the ladder being superposed an uneven support surface. The frame includes two rear leg members and a front leg member having a platform member operably coupled to the top thereof. The front leg member is hingedly secured to the platform member and movable between a deployed and stored position. The three leg members include an upper portion and a lower portion wherein the lower portion is slidably engaged with the upper portion. A clamp member is disposed in each of the three leg members and is configured to operably engage a portion of the lower portion of each of the three leg members. The clamp member includes opposing jaw members with a void therebetween.

Extension Ladder with Groove Box Rails and Method
An extension ladder having a base section having a first box shaped base rail having a base side and a groove extending along the side. The extension ladder has a fly section having a first box shaped fly rail, and a follower bracket attached to the first box shaped fly rail and extending outward toward the first box shaped base rail. The groove is sized to engage the follower bracket which constrains the fly section to have limited motion relative to the base section and a left to right and front to rear directions while permitting the fly section to slide freely relative to the base section when the fly section is extended. A method for using an extension ladder. A method for producing an extension ladder.
Ladder with Box Rails Having a Collar and Method
A ladder having a right box rail having an outer web with an outer opening and an inner web with an inner opening. The ladder having a left box rail in parallel and spaced relation with the right box rail. The ladder comprises a hollow collar disposed in between the inner opening of the inner web and the outer opening of the outer web. The collar having a stem having a plurality of segments. The segments separated by slots. The ladder having a first rung attached to the right and left box rails. The first rung having a right end that extends through the outer opening, the collar and the inner opening. A method for using a ladder by a user. A method for forming a ladder.
